1 Place Value with decimals through millionths

2 Starting with the ones place, let’s name the places together, in order, from ones to millions: ones tens hundreds thousands ten thousands hundred thousands millions

3 ones tens hundreds thousands ten thousands hundred thousands millions Starting at the decimal point, the places are named in the same order except: there is not a “ones” place all names end in “ths” (.) decimal tenths hundredths thousandths ten thousandths hundred thousandths millionths Now add place value chart to spiral notebook, and add diff ways to read/write #s on another page.

6 How to read and write decimals: Write the following number in word form: Step 1: Write the word name for the #s to the left of or before the decimal point. forty Step 2 : Write and & the word name for the #s to the right of the decimal point. forty and three hundred eighteen Step 3: Write the place value name of the final digit after the decimal point. forty and three hundred eighteen thousandths

15 Try to write the following number in standard form: Four and twenty-nine millionths ** Remember: when writing a decimal in standard form, start by placing the decimals in the correct place and then work backwards. Use your chart in your spiral notebook to help you write this number.
